Master Cylinder Location - 2015+ USDM / JDM~UKDM
Hi,
Im looking at a master cylinder brace to get rid of some of the sponginess when hard braking, and the only suppliers I can find are US based so obviously serve the USDM. I cannot find any clear information regarding the master cylinder location on US cars vs UK cars, but my hunch is that its on the opposite side and the brace is therefore useless.
Does anyone have any info on this?

The master cylinder for US cars is on the LH side.
RHD Cusco Brake Cylinder Stopper (STi 2015+) Part number 6A1 561 A
LHD Cusco Brake Cylinder Stopper (STi 2015+) Part number 6A1 561 ALHD
